Explanation:
9(x + y)2 - 4(x - y)2
Using difference of two squares which says
a2 - b2 = (a + b)(a - b) = 9(x + y)2 - 4(x - y)2
= [3(x + y)]2 - [2(x - y)]-2
= [3(x + y) + 2(x - y) + 2(x - y)][3(x + y) - 2(x - y)]
= [3x +3y + 2x - 2y][3x + 3y - 2x + 2y]
= (5x + y)(x + 5y)
